The global allograft market is poised for significant growth and development as we progress into the next decade. The industry is projected to witness a substantial increase from 670.75 USD million in 2022 to reach 1083.46 USD million by 2030.

This growth can be attributed to various factors such as increasing awareness about allograft procedures, advancements in tissue banking techniques, rising prevalence of musculoskeletal disorders, and the growing adoption of allografts in surgical procedures. The industry is expected to experience a positive outlook with a surge in demand for allografts across orthopedic, dental, and other medical applications.

In terms of types of allografts, the market encompasses a range of products including Demineralized Bone Matrix (DBM), Machined Allografts, Soft Tissue Allografts, and other specialized offerings. Each type serves specific medical needs and applications, catering to a diverse patient population requiring interventions in different areas such as bone reconstruction, soft tissue repair, and more.
The application of allografts in dentistry, orthopedics, wound care, spinal surgeries, trauma treatment, and other medical fields demonstrates the versatility and efficacy of these products. Allografts offer a viable alternative to traditional treatments, providing patients with effective solutions for various health conditions and improving overall clinical outcomes.
